I like this very much, and I want to listen to it more and more. After two listens I am still clueless of how this music emerged. Sure there is a heavy/psych 60's vibe with all these fuzzy bass/guitar sounds, along with fusion elements but they do have a way to conceal the origins of their art. I appreciate a lot the way they concentrate on writing songs, instead of instrumental passages.
Anyway, that's the kind of music I want to hear nowadays. It's intriguing, it's unsettling, it has something fresh to offer. I am not an expert but there seems to be a lot of this stuff coming from France recently.
